Understanding Single-Set Training
Single-set training, often associated with high-intensity training (HIT) principles, involves performing only one working set of an exercise to or very near muscular failure. Unlike traditional multi-set protocols that might involve 3-5 sets per exercise, single-set training emphasizes maximal effort and intensity within that single set, aiming to stimulate muscle growth and strength adaptations efficiently. This approach gained prominence through pioneers like Arthur Jones (Nautilus) and Mike Mentzer, who argued that once an effective stimulus is achieved, additional sets offer diminishing returns and can even impede recovery.
The Science Behind Single-Set Training Efficacy
The effectiveness of single-set training has been a subject of extensive research in exercise science. While some studies suggest a slight advantage for multiple sets in maximizing hypertrophy or strength gains, particularly in advanced trainees, a substantial body of evidence supports single-set training as a viable and effective method.
- Intensity over Volume: The core principle is that the quality of the single set – specifically, its intensity and proximity to muscular failure – is paramount. When performed with high effort, a single set can effectively recruit a significant number of muscle fibers, leading to a strong adaptive stimulus.
- Minimum Effective Dose: Research indicates that there's a "minimum effective dose" of resistance training volume required for physiological adaptations. For many, especially beginners and intermediate lifters, this minimum can often be achieved with a single, challenging set.
- Diminishing Returns: Beyond a certain point, adding more sets may not yield proportional increases in results and can instead increase the risk of overtraining, extend recovery times, and heighten the potential for injury.
Benefits of Single-Set Training
Adopting a single-set approach offers several compelling advantages:
- Exceptional Time Efficiency: This is perhaps the most significant benefit. A full-body workout can be completed in a fraction of the time compared to multi-set routines, making it ideal for individuals with busy schedules.
- Reduced Overtraining Risk: Less overall volume means less systemic stress, allowing for faster recovery between workouts and potentially reducing the risk of overtraining syndrome.
- Improved Recovery: Muscles and the central nervous system recover more quickly, potentially allowing for more frequent training sessions if desired.
- Accessibility for Beginners: The lower volume can be less intimidating and easier to manage for those new to resistance training, allowing them to focus on mastering form before increasing volume.
- Sustainable Long-Term: Its efficiency and lower recovery demands can make it a more sustainable training approach for consistent adherence over many years.
- Effective for Maintenance: For advanced trainees looking to maintain strength and muscle mass without dedicating extensive time, single-set training can be highly effective.
Limitations and Considerations
While beneficial, single-set training is not without its limitations:
- Requires High Intensity: For single-set training to be effective, each set must be taken to or very close to muscular failure. This requires significant mental fortitude and a high tolerance for discomfort. Sub-maximal single sets will yield minimal results.
- Less Optimal for Maximal Hypertrophy/Strength: For elite bodybuilders or powerlifters whose primary goal is to maximize muscle mass or absolute strength, multiple sets typically provide a superior stimulus due to the higher total volume.
- Precision in Execution: With only one set, there's less room for error. Proper form is critical to target the muscle effectively and prevent injury.
- Limited Practice for Complex Lifts: For highly technical lifts like squats or deadlifts, performing only one working set may not provide enough practice for motor learning and skill acquisition, especially for beginners.

Optimizing Your Single-Set Workout
To maximize the effectiveness of your single-set routine, consider these principles:
- Warm-Up Adequately: Always perform 1-2 light warm-up sets for each exercise to prepare the muscles and joints, regardless of the number of working sets.
- Select Compound Exercises: Prioritize multi-joint movements (e.g., squats, deadlifts, presses, rows) as they engage more muscle groups simultaneously, making your single set more efficient.
- Focus on Repetition Range: Aim for a repetition range that allows you to reach muscular failure within 6-15 repetitions, depending on your goal (lower reps for strength, higher for hypertrophy/endurance).
- Intensity is Key: Each working set should be taken to the point where you cannot perform another repetition with good form (muscular failure), or very close to it (1-2 repetitions in reserve, RIR).
- Control the Movement: Execute each repetition with a controlled tempo, focusing on the eccentric (lowering) phase to maximize time under tension.
- Progressive Overload: Continually strive to improve. This means either increasing the weight, performing more repetitions with the same weight, or improving your form over time. Without progressive overload, adaptations will plateau.
- Appropriate Frequency: While a single set per exercise is low volume, you might train more frequently (e.g., 2-3 full-body workouts per week) to provide consistent stimulus and practice.
When to Consider Multiple Sets
While single-set training is highly effective, there are scenarios where incorporating multiple sets per exercise may be more advantageous:
- Maximal Hypertrophy: For bodybuilders or individuals whose primary goal is to maximize muscle size, higher training volumes (typically achieved through multiple sets) often lead to greater hypertrophy, especially in advanced trainees.
- Strength Specialization: Powerlifters or those aiming for maximal strength in specific lifts often benefit from multiple sets to practice technique under load and accumulate volume at higher intensities.
- Skill Acquisition: For complex movements, multiple sets provide more opportunities to practice and refine motor patterns.
- Specific Populations: Some athletes or individuals with very specific physiological adaptations in mind may require higher volumes.
